Design features of the Stinol starting device

In refrigerators of the Stinol brand, especially in the popular models of the 103, 104 and 107 series, electromagnetic ones are most often used RT type starting relays. These devices are structurally different from modern solid-state analogues used in inverter models. They are a body made of heat-resistant plastic, inside of which there is a coil, a movable core and a contact group. It is the electromagnetic principle of operation that ensures the closure of the starting winding of the engine at the moment of start.

It is important to note that in some modifications the starting relay can be combined with a thermal protective relay in a single unit, although more often they are two separate elements put on the contacts of the compressor. Thermal protection responsible for breaking the circuit when overheated motor, preventing its combustion, while the starting relay provides the initial jerk of the rotor. The separation of these functions simplifies diagnostics: if the motor hums and clicks, but does not start, the problem most often lies in the starting mechanism.

The dimensions and shape of the relay housing may vary depending on the component manufacturer (for example, Danfoss, Ranco or domestic analogues), but the seats on the compressor terminals standardized. This allows you to use compatible spare parts during repairs. Understanding how it works helps you not to confuse it with other elements of the refrigerator's electrical circuit. starting device, helps not to confuse it with other elements of the electrical circuit of the refrigerator.

⚠️ Attention: The housings of old relays can be made of fragile carbolite, which can easily crack if handled carelessly. Be extremely careful when removing the device from the contacts of the compressor so as not to damage it mechanically, even if you plan to replace it.

To accurately identify the part when ordering a new one, it is recommended to remove the old one and study the markings on its body. The numbers and letters stamped on the plastic will indicate the type of device and compatibility with your motor. For example, marking RTK-1 or P-3 can be found in different batches of Stinol equipment. Using a relay that is not suitable for the operating current can lead to frequent shutdowns of the motor or, conversely, to its overheating.

The exact location of the relay in different models

To find the relay, you need to disconnect the refrigerator from the power supply and move it away from the wall, providing access to the back panel. In 99% of cases of Stinol refrigerators, the required element is located directly on the side of the compressor (usually on the left, when looking at the refrigerator from the back). It is closed with a plastic or metal casing, which serves as protection against dust, moisture and mechanical damage.

The detection process is as follows:

  • 🔍 Inspect the bottom of the back wall of the refrigerator - there you will see a black round or oval tank (compressor).
  • 🔧 Find the box (casing), fixed on the side surface of the motor with a clamp or screw.
  • ⚡ Inside this box, on the protruding contacts of the compressor, there is a starting relay along with a heat sensor.

In some rare cases, especially in two-compressor models, each motor has its own automatic starting kit, located in a similar way. If you are servicing a built-in Stinol model, access to the rear panel may be difficult, and you will need to remove the lower base or completely pull the equipment out of the niche. The main thing is not to confuse the relay with a capacitor or thermostat, which may be located nearby, but have a different shape and mounting method.

Access to the relay in models with the No Frost system may be a little more difficult due to the presence of additional panels and air ducts in the lower part, but the very principle of the location of the unit on the compressor remains unchanged. Always check that the condenser grille or water collection tray is not obstructing access. If necessary, the tray can be temporarily removed by unscrewing the mounting screws.

Step-by-step instructions for dismantling the relay

The process of removing the starting device requires a minimal set of tools, usually a flat screwdriver and pliers are enough. Before starting work, make sure that the refrigerator is unplugged for at least 15-20 minutes so that the residual charge in the capacitors has time to dissipate and the oil in the compressor has cleared. This is critically important for your safety and the safety of your equipment.

Algorithm for removing the relay:

  1. Remove the protective casing by bending the fixing metal tabs or unscrewing the fastening screw.
  2. Carefully disconnect the wire terminals that go to the relay. It is recommended to first photograph the connection diagram so as not to confuse the contacts during assembly.
  3. Remove the relay from the compressor contacts. It is usually simply put on three pins and secured with a tight fit or a plastic clip.
  4. Inspect the device for external damage: melting, cracks, burning smell.

When removing, avoid sudden jerks, as you can damage the compressor leads, which are made of brittle metal. If the relay is “stuck” or is sitting very tightly, slightly rock it from side to side. In Stinol models, a situation often occurs when the internal plastic sleeve is destroyed and the relay remains hanging on the wires - in this case it must be replaced entirely.

After removing the device, it is necessary to carry out a visual inspection. Shake the relay near your ear: if you hear the ringing of a detached core or contacts inside, the device is definitely faulty. Also pay attention to the condition of the contact pads - they must be clean, free of black carbon and oxides. The presence of burning inside the housing indicates a short circuit or overheating.

Diagnostics and performance testing

The relay is checked using a multimeter switched to resistance measurement mode (Ohms). This allows you to determine the integrity of the windings and the condition of the contacts. A faulty relay is the most common reason why the Stinol refrigerator hums but does not turn on. Diagnostics takes only a few minutes, but requires care.

Main parameters to check:

  • Coil resistance: should be within normal limits (usually 30-60 Ohms), lack of resistance indicates a break.
  • 🔄 Contacts: in normal condition (horizontal position) the contacts of the starting winding must be open.
  • 🔥 Thermal relay: checked for ringing of the circuit, the resistance should be close to zero (if it is not overheated).

If the multimeter shows infinity where there should be a contact, or zero where there should be no contact, the relay must be replaced. It is also worth checking the thermal protection: it should open the circuit when heated. At home, it is difficult to check this accurately without heating, so the entire unit assembly is often replaced, especially if the device has been in service for more than 10 years.

⚠️ Attention: Do not try to repair the relay by stripping the contacts or bending the plates. This is a temporary measure that can lead to contact sticking and burnout of the compressor windings. Only a complete replacement guarantees reliability.

The table below shows the main symptoms and their probable causes associated with the relay:

Symptom Probable cause Action
The refrigerator hums for 3-5 seconds and clicks The starting relay is faulty or the compressor is jammed Replacing the relay, checking the compressor
Full silence, there is light Open circuit in the thermal relay or broken wire Checking the circuit with a multimeter
The compressor is hot, but does not work Thermal protection has tripped Give cool down, check the ventilation
Frequent switching on and off The relay is incorrectly selected or the thermostat is faulty Checking the relay markings

It is important to distinguish between a broken relay and a malfunction of the engine itself. If, after replacing the relay with a known good one, the situation does not change (the humming and clicking continues), the problem may lie in an interturn short circuit of the compressor windings or its mechanical jamming. In such cases, you need to call a professional technician for a deeper diagnosis.

Replacing the relay and connection features

Installing a new relay in the Stinol refrigerator is done in the reverse order of removal. The key here is to properly orient the device relative to the ground. There is always a marking UP or TOPon the relay body, as well as an arrow pointing up. This is not just a recommendation, but a technical requirement: the electromagnetic core must move vertically under the influence of gravity and the magnetic field.

If the relay is installed incorrectly (upside down or sideways), it will not be able to correctly open the starting circuit. This will cause the starting winding to remain on for too long, causing it to overheat and burn out, or the motor will not start at all. Therefore, during installation, make sure that the inscription TOP looks straight up.

What to do if the new relay does not fit in shape?

If the purchased relay differs in shape from the original, but has similar electrical characteristics and mounting holes, it can be installed. The main thing is to ensure reliable contact with the compressor terminals. Sometimes it is necessary to slightly bend the housing mounting brackets. However, if the holes do not match, it is better to look for an exact analogue so as not to create vibration and stress on the contacts.

After installing the relay and connecting all the wires, assemble the protective casing. Make sure that the wires are not pinched or touching hot parts of the compressor or refrigeration system pipes. Plug in the refrigerator and listen: the startup should go smoothly, without long buzzes and clicks. The motor should pick up speed and go into operating mode.

Common mistakes during self-repair

Independent repair of Stinol refrigerators, despite its apparent simplicity, is fraught with risks. One of the most common mistakes is ignoring the markings when purchasing a new part. Owners often buy the first relay they come across that is similar in design, without paying attention to the operating current. Compressors of different capacities require relays with different characteristics.

Another common mistake is trying to start a refrigerator with a faulty relay using the “fist” or tapping method. This is a barbaric method that can temporarily start the motor, but is guaranteed to kill the starting winding. It is also dangerous to leave the refrigerator turned on with a faulty relay for a long time: cyclical attempts to start (buzzing-clicking) quickly disable both the relay and the thermal protection.

Do not forget about safety:

  • 🚫 Never work with electrical equipment with wet hands.
  • 🚫 Do not leave the refrigerator plugged in with the relay cover removed.
  • 🚫 Do not use wire or foil to close the contacts instead of the relay.

If after all the procedures the refrigerator behaves strangely, makes unusual sounds or does not freeze, do not continue the experiments. Perhaps the problem is deeper than simply replacing the relay, and requires the intervention of a specialist with professional equipment.

FAQ: Frequently asked questions

Is it possible to use a relay from another refrigerator on Stinol?

Yes, it is possible if the electrical characteristics (operation current, type of windings) and the geometric dimensions of the landings match holes. It is important that the relay is rated for the power of your compressor. Universal relays often come complete with adapters, but it is better to look for an original or a complete analogue.

Why does a new relay burn out a week after replacement?

This may indicate problems with the compressor itself (for example, difficult starting due to wear-out of the mechanical part) or voltage surges in the network. Also, the reason may be incorrect installation of the relay (not level) or a defective new part.

How much does it cost to replace a relay in the compared to DIY service?

The cost of the part itself is low, but calling a specialist and his work can cost 2-3 times more than the spare part itself. However, a do-it-yourself replacement only warrants the part, whereas a repairman often provides a warranty on the work. If you are not confident in your abilities, it is better to trust the professionals.

Where to find the relay marking if it is erased?

If the marking on the body is not readable, you can try to find it on a diagram attached inside the refrigerator (usually on the back wall or inside the chamber). You can also choose an analogue, knowing the model of the compressor (indicated on the tag of the motor itself) and the power of the refrigerator.

Is it dangerous to operate a refrigerator with a faulty relay?

Yes, it is dangerous. In addition to the risk of fire due to overheating of the wiring, this can lead to permanent failure of the compressor, the replacement of which is not economically feasible. At the first signs of a malfunction (clicking, humming), it is better to turn off the refrigerator.
